Active kids are winners

CASEY kids recently celebrated the Commonwealth Games when Westfield Fountain Gate hosted fun sporting activities.
Children got active with the YMCA, which held Healthy Kids, Aqua Guard and Fun with Gymnastics sessions at the shopping centre. Beach House Fitness Centre in Narre Warren also hosted many fun events with children enjoying tunnelball, baton relay walks, skipping relay races, a bean-bag shot put and other fun events.
